Adam Ondra frees Ledoborec, 8C+ boulder problem at Holštejn in Czech Republic

The video of Adam Ondra making the first ascent of Ledoborec at the crag Holštejn. Graded 8C+, this is one of the hardest boulder problems in the Czech Republic.

"Maybe not the best line but its hard and it’s been on my mind for a while. That’s why it needs to be done." In his herculean effort to leave no project incomplete, on 24 May 2020 Adam Ondra sent Ledoborec, a linkup of two existing boulder problems that weighs in at 8C+. I.e. one of the hardest boulder problems in the world seeing that currently there is just one 9A, Burden of Dreams freed in Finland in 2016 by Nalle Hukkatavaial, and only a handful of other 8C+.
